The Williamson effect /

Fourteen tales and two poems based on the ideas and characters of Jack Williamson, 88, one of the greats of science fiction. The tales include Pati Nagle's Emancipation, a story of religion in space, and John Brunner's Thinkertoy, on a nasty robot.
